Sounding reference signal transmission

1. A method comprising:
- a) receiving, by a wireless device, at least one control message from a base station, said at least one control message causing in said wireless device;
i) configuration of a plurality of cells comprising a primary cell and at least one secondary cell;
ii) assignment of each of said at least one secondary cell to a cell group in a plurality of cell groups; and
iii) configuration of transmissions of sounding reference signals (SRSs) on a first cell in said plurality of cells, said first cell being assigned to a first cell group in said plurality of cell groups, said SRSs comprising a first SRS and a second SRS;
b) transmitting, by said wireless device, said first SRS on said first cell in parallel with transmission of at least one of;
i) a first random access preamble in a second cell group different from said first cell group; and
ii) a first uplink data packet on a second cell different from said first cell; and
c) dropping, by said wireless device, said second SRS in a symbol of a subframe if at least one of the following conditions is satisfied;
i) a second random access preamble is transmitted overlapping said symbol in said first cell group;
ii) a second uplink data packet is transmitted overlapping said symbol in said first cell; and
iii) said wireless device has insufficient power to transmit said second SRS in parallel with other uplink transmissions in said plurality of cells.

Abstract
A wireless device transmits a first sounding reference signal on a first cell of a first cell group in parallel with transmission of at least one of a first random access preamble in a second cell group, and a first uplink data packet on a second cell. The wireless device drops a second sounding reference signal in a symbol of the first cell if at least one of the following conditions is satisfied: a second random access preamble is transmitted overlapping the symbol in the first cell group, and a second uplink packet is transmitted overlapping the symbol in the first cell.
